I’ve had one for a year. Put about 600 rounds thru it. Mix of suppressed and unsuppressed. I really like it a lot. Haven’t had any issues with it besides it won’t cycle on cci quiets. If you can find one under 2 bills, get it. For what you get it’s a steal. Good trigger, threaded, fiber optic sight and 3 mags. My only wish is that it had a push button mag release instead of the paddle thing.

It's the first gun EVER that I've paid over MSRP for, as others have pointed out. Been jones'n to try it, and this LGS' price was only high...not insane, LOL.

Only been out once, and I had both types of CCI Hi-Vel to get through it. Ran like a champ, and then I put some old Fed red-box bulk pack through it. No problems. I love the sharp contrast to the sights, and the mild green F/O of the front. Safety is positive in both directions. You may expect a horrible trigger, but it's actually quite short, light and usable.

Downside is that mags are a royal PITA to load. This is an uplula tool job, for sure. Otherwise, point 'em nose-up, rim down as you mash them down atop one another. Then, swing the bullet forward as you stuff the rim back up and under the feed-lips. Trying to load it like a centerfire will only make you sore and angry.
